[And That's That] [Epigraph] In this half year I have again seen much blood and many tears, yet all I have are merely miscellaneous jottings. The tears wiped away, the blood gone; the butchers roam free, ever free, those with steel blades, those with soft knives. Yet all I have are merely 'miscellaneous jottings.' When even the 'miscellaneous jottings' were 'put where they belong,' all I had left was 'and that's that' - and that's that! The eight lines above were written on the night of October 14, 1926, at the end of the collection completed up to that date. I now take them as the epigraph for the 1927 collection. October 30, 1928, Lu Xun, noted upon completion of proofreading. |
